Kinds of Keys and Their Replacement
Before diving into the replacement alternatives, it is important to understand the different types of keys available. Each kind of key has a special replacement process and expense related to it.
Key Types
Conventional Keys:
Used for the majority of old-school locks.Replacement typically needs checking out a locksmith professional or hardware shop.
Transponder Keys:
Typically used for vehicles.Consist of a chip that communicates with the car's ignition system.Replacement frequently needs programming by a dealership or locksmith.
Smart Keys:
Used in keyless entry systems.Often described as "fob keys."Replacement can be more intricate and may involve electronic programming.
Skeleton Keys:
Designed to open a variety of locks.Replacement is rare but can be carried out by specialized locksmith professionals.
Electronic Keys:
Used in digital locks and safes.Replacement depends on the specific model and brand name of the lock.Table 1: Key Types and Replacement ConsiderationsKey TypeReplacement MethodCost RangeTypical UsageStandard KeysLocksmith/Hardware Store₤ 1 - ₤ 10Residential and office doorsTransponder KeysCar Dealership/Locksmith₤ 75 - ₤ 300Automobiles with immobilizer innovationSmart KeysDealership/Locksmith₤ 100 - ₤ 500Modern carsSkeleton KeysSpecialized Locksmith₤ 10 - ₤ 50Older locksElectronic KeysBrand-Specific Services₤ 50 - ₤ 300Digital locks and safesReplacement Processes
Understanding the particular process for replacing different kinds of keys can assist individuals choose the most efficient approach.
Standard KeysRecognize the lock: Determine the type of lock and its particular key design.Visit a locksmith or hardware store: Most shops can cut keys based on a physical copy.Demand duplicates: Provide the initial key for duplication.Transponder KeysLocate the key code: This info is frequently discovered in the owner's manual or can be retrieved from the dealership.Go to a dealership or locksmith: Require specialized devices for shows.Get a new key: The brand-new key will need to be programmed to your vehicle's system.Smart KeysContact your vehicle's producer: Sometimes this is needed to validate ownership.Visit the dealer: Most producers can supply replacement wise keys linked to the vehicle's system.Program the key: This may be done on-site or from another location.Electronic KeysInspect the manufacturer: The procedure and expense can differ significantly.Obtain a replacement: Contact client service or a certified locksmith.Program the key: Often done digitally by following specific directions.Cost Factors for Keys Replacement
Replacement expenses can differ extensively based upon several factors:
Type of Key: Some keys, especially electronic and transponder keys, are costlier than traditional keys.Key Complexity: The more complex the key (i.e., clever keys), the higher the replacement cost.Setting Requirements: Keys that require programs frequently have extra expenses.Service Provider: Dealerships tend to charge more for replacement keys compared to local locksmiths.Table 2: Estimated Costs for Key ReplacementKey TypeEstimated Replacement CostStandard Key₤ 1 - ₤ 10Transponder Key₤ 75 - ₤ 300Smart Key₤ 100 - ₤ 500Skeleton Key₤ 10 - ₤ 50Electronic Key₤ 50 - ₤ 300FAQs About Keys Replacement1. How do I understand if I require to replace my key or lock?
If your key is damaged or lost, and you can not access your residential or commercial property, it is recommended to replace it. If you have issues about security, consider altering the locks completely.
2. Can I replace a lost transponder key without a spare?
Yes, you can replace a lost transponder key, however you'll need to provide proof of ownership, and the replacement will likely cost more due to the programs included.
3. Is it safe to utilize a locksmith service?
Yes, it is generally safe how to get replacement keys for Car utilize a locksmith. It's best to verify their qualifications and read evaluations beforehand.
4. What if I lost my key fob?
In case of a lost key fob, you typically require to contact your dealership for a replacement. Be prepared for the possibility of extra costs for shows.
5. How can I avoid losing keys in the future?Usage key finders or wise trackers.Designate a particular location for your keys in your home.Regularly examine that you have your keys before leaving any area.
